创建一个带有通知计数指示器的"badge"自定义视图,可以通过以下步骤实现:
- 首先,定义一个自定义视图类,命名为"BadgeView",继承自适合你所使用的前端开发框架或库的基础视图类。
- 在"BadgeView"类中,添加一个用于显示通知计数的文本标签,并设置其样式和位置。
- 添加一个属性或方法,用于更新通知计数的值。这可以是一个整数类型的属性,表示当前的通知计数。
- 在"BadgeView"类中,添加一个方法,用于增加或减少通知计数的值。这可以是两个独立的方法,一个用于增加计数,另一个用于减少计数。
- 根据你所使用的前端开发框架或库的事件处理机制,为"BadgeView"类添加一个方法,用于响应用户点击或触摸事件。在该方法中,你可以执行一些操作,例如打开通知列表或清零通知计数。
- 最后,将"BadgeView"类实例化并添加到你的应用程序或网页中的适当位置。你可以根据需要设置其样式和位置。
这样,你就创建了一个带有通知计数指示器的"badge"自定义视图。用户可以通过点击或触摸该视图来执行相应的操作,并且通知计数会根据用户的操作进行更新。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云前端开发相关产品:https://cloud.tencent.com/product/web
- 腾讯云后端开发相关产品:https://cloud.tencent.com/product/scf
- 腾讯云软件测试相关产品:https://cloud.tencent.com/product/cts
- 腾讯云数据库相关产品:https://cloud.tencent.com/product/cdb
- 腾讯云服务器运维相关产品:https://cloud.tencent.com/product/cvm
- 腾讯云云原生相关产品:https://cloud.tencent.com/product/tke
- 腾讯云网络通信相关产品:https://cloud.tencent.com/product/vpc
- 腾讯云网络安全相关产品:https://cloud.tencent.com/product/ddos
- 腾讯云音视频相关产品:https://cloud.tencent.com/product/tiia
- 腾讯云多媒体处理相关产品:https://cloud.tencent.com/product/mps
- 腾讯云人工智能相关产品:https://cloud.tencent.com/product/ai
- 腾讯云物联网相关产品:https://cloud.tencent.com/product/iotexplorer
- 腾讯云移动开发相关产品:https://cloud.tencent.com/product/cos
- 腾讯云存储相关产品:https://cloud.tencent.com/product/cos
- 腾讯云区块链相关产品:https://cloud.tencent.com/product/baas
- 腾讯云元宇宙相关产品:https://cloud.tencent.com/product/3d